To clarify the PDUFA, once the FDA accepts a filing for the approval of a drug, the agency is expected to complete its review process within 10 months. The date at the end of the review period is referred to as the PDUFA date.

Sometimes, the FDA grants Priority Review status to the regulatory filing for a drug. This designation is given to therapies that could significantly improve the safety or effectiveness of the treatment, diagnosis, or prevention of serious diseases. This is a really big deal, and I can see now why the LPCN stock price has been increasing as the March 28th date approaches. When the FDA grants Priority Review for a drug, the PDUFA data is six months from the acceptance of the submission.

While PDUFA dates are set after a regulatory filing is accepted, the dates can sometimes slide, most often when additional data is required from the drugmaker or the company submits new data that requires more time to review.

Lipocine Inc., is a clinical-stage biopharmaceutical company headquartered in Salt Lake City, developing pharmaceuticals for the treatment of metabolic and endocrine disorders. Its primary development programs are based on oral delivery solutions for poorly bioavailable drugs.

The company products are designed to facilitate lower dosing requirements, and reduce side effects, and gastrointestinal interactions that limit bioavailability. Its lead product candidate is TLANDO, an oral testosterone replacement therapy, that we are discussing today.

Per the BBI website, Sofpironium bromide is being developed in the U.S. as a potential topical therapy for the treatment of primary axillary hyperhidrosis, or excessive underarm sweating.

In October 2021, Brickell announced positive topline results from the U.S. Phase 3 clinical program for sofpironium bromide gel, 15%, in which all primary and secondary endpoints were met and achieved statistical significance. Based on the results from the Phase 3 pivotal program, Brickell expects to submit a New Drug Application, or NDA, to the U.S. FDA in mid-2022.

Previously, in September 2020 Brickell’s development partner, Kaken Pharmaceutical Co., Ltd., received approval to manufacture and market sofpironium bromide gel under the brand name ECCLOCK® in Japan. Kaken launched ECCLOCK commercially in November 2020, marking the first commercialization of this therapy.

InflaRx’s lead drug candidate, Vilobelimab, is a first-in-class monoclonal antibody currently in clinical development for several indications.

In a first clinical Phase IIa multi-center placebo-controlled dose escalation study in patients suffering from early septic organ dysfunction, biological proof of concept was established, demonstrating its unique C5a blocking ability as well as selectivity.
